In compliance with Federal Regulations, following are repro-
duction of labels on, or inside the product relating to laser
product safety.
KENWOOD-Corp. certifies this equipment conforms to DHHS
Regulations No.21 CFR 1040. 10, Chapter 1, subchapter J.
DANGER : Laser radiation when open and interlock defeated.
AVOID DIRECT EXPOSURE TO BEAM.
